Changeset 1490 in products
- Timestamp:
- Dec 30, 2009 1:28:04 PM (14 years ago)
- Location:
- quintagroup.transmogrify.simpleblog2quills/trunk
- Files:
-
- 17 edited
- 1 moved
Legend:
- Unmodified
- Added
- Removed
-
quintagroup.transmogrify.simpleblog2quills/trunk/README.txt
r594 r1490 1 quintagroup.transmogrif ier.simpleblog2quills1 quintagroup.transmogrify.simpleblog2quills 2 2 ============================================ 3 3 … … 26 26 problem with absolute links, because site URL isn't known. To make it possible 27 27 to fix absolute links please edit export configuration file 'export.cfg', 28 which is located in 'quintagroup /transmogrifier/simpleblog2quills' folder.28 which is located in 'quintagroup.transmogrify.simpleblog2quills' folder. 29 29 Find in that file line that starts with "site-urls = " and change values 30 30 that come after it to your site URL. … … 34 34 Quills_ or QuillsEnabled_ plone product is required. When migrating blog to 35 35 QuillsEnabled please edit import configuration file 'import.cfg' located in 36 'quintagroup /transmogrifier/simpleblog2quills' folder (comments in that file36 'quintagroup.transmogrify.simpleblog2quills' folder (comments in that file 37 37 will guide you through necessary modifications) and install this product in 38 38 QuickInstaller (this will enable 'Large Folder' content type and change … … 46 46 Run next command: 47 47 48 bin/instance test -s quintagroup.transmogrif ier.simpleblog2quills \48 bin/instance test -s quintagroup.transmogrify.simpleblog2quills \ 49 49 -m test_import 50 50 -
quintagroup.transmogrify.simpleblog2quills/trunk/docs/HISTORY.txt
r293 r1490 1 Changelog for quintagroup.transmogrif ier.simpleblog2quills1 Changelog for quintagroup.transmogrify.simpleblog2quills 2 2 3 3 (name of developer listed in brackets) 4 4 5 quintagroup.transmogrif ier.simpleblog2quills - 0.1 Unreleased5 quintagroup.transmogrify.simpleblog2quills - 0.1 Unreleased 6 6 7 7 - Initial package structure. -
quintagroup.transmogrify.simpleblog2quills/trunk/docs/INSTALL.txt
r293 r1490 1 quintagroup.transmogrif ier.simpleblog2quills Installation1 quintagroup.transmogrify.simpleblog2quills Installation 2 2 ========================== 3 3 4 To install quintagroup.transmogrif ier.simpleblog2quills into the global Python environment (or a workingenv),4 To install quintagroup.transmogrify.simpleblog2quills into the global Python environment (or a workingenv), 5 5 using a traditional Zope 2 instance, you can do this: 6 6 7 7 * When you're reading this you have probably already run 8 ``easy_install quintagroup.transmogrif ier.simpleblog2quills``. Find out how to install setuptools8 ``easy_install quintagroup.transmogrify.simpleblog2quills``. Find out how to install setuptools 9 9 (and EasyInstall) here: 10 10 http://peak.telecommunity.com/DevCenter/EasyInstall 11 11 12 * Create a file called ``quintagroup.transmogrif ier.simpleblog2quills-configure.zcml`` in the12 * Create a file called ``quintagroup.transmogrify.simpleblog2quills-configure.zcml`` in the 13 13 ``/path/to/instance/etc/package-includes`` directory. The file 14 14 should only contain this:: 15 15 16 <include package="quintagroup.transmogrif ier.simpleblog2quills" />16 <include package="quintagroup.transmogrify.simpleblog2quills" /> 17 17 18 18 … … 20 20 recipe to manage your project, you can do this: 21 21 22 * Add ``quintagroup.transmogrif ier.simpleblog2quills`` to the list of eggs to install, e.g.:22 * Add ``quintagroup.transmogrify.simpleblog2quills`` to the list of eggs to install, e.g.: 23 23 24 24 [buildout] … … 26 26 eggs = 27 27 ... 28 quintagroup.transmogrif ier.simpleblog2quills28 quintagroup.transmogrify.simpleblog2quills 29 29 30 30 * Tell the plone.recipe.zope2instance recipe to install a ZCML slug: … … 34 34 ... 35 35 zcml = 36 quintagroup.transmogrif ier.simpleblog2quills36 quintagroup.transmogrify.simpleblog2quills 37 37 38 38 * Re-run buildout, e.g. with: -
quintagroup.transmogrify.simpleblog2quills/trunk/docs/LICENSE.txt
r293 r1490 1 quintagroup.transmogrif ier.simpleblog2quills is copyright Quintagroup1 quintagroup.transmogrify.simpleblog2quills is copyright Quintagroup 2 2 3 3 This program is free software; you can redistribute it and/or modify -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/__init__.py
r1244 r1490 10 10 profile_registry.registerProfile( 11 11 name="default", 12 title="quintagroup.transmogrif ier.simpleblog2quills (enables Large Plone Folder)",12 title="quintagroup.transmogrify.simpleblog2quills (enables Large Plone Folder)", 13 13 description="Extension profile for applying settings needed to migrate blog.", 14 14 path=profile_path, 15 product="quintagroup.transmogrif ier.simpleblog2quills", # this is required15 product="quintagroup.transmogrify.simpleblog2quills", # this is required 16 16 profile_type=EXTENSION, 17 17 for_=IPloneSiteRoot -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/activator.py
r638 r1490 18 18 pass 19 19 20 from quintagroup.transmogrif ier.simpleblog2quills.adapters import IMAGE_FOLDER20 from quintagroup.transmogrify.simpleblog2quills.adapters import IMAGE_FOLDER 21 21 22 22 class BlogActivatorSection(object): -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/adapters.py
r1241 r1490 18 18 from quintagroup.transmogrifier.logger import VALIDATIONKEY 19 19 20 from quintagroup.transmogrif ier.simpleblog2quills.interfaces import IExportItemManipulator, IBlog20 from quintagroup.transmogrify.simpleblog2quills.interfaces import IExportItemManipulator, IBlog 21 21 22 22 # URL of the site, where blog is located (this is needed to fix links in entries) -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/configure.zcml
r612 r1490 4 4 xmlns:zcml="http://namespaces.zope.org/zcml" 5 5 xmlns:transmogrifier="http://namespaces.plone.org/transmogrifier" 6 i18n_domain="quintagroup.transmogrif ier.simpleblog2quills">6 i18n_domain="quintagroup.transmogrify.simpleblog2quills"> 7 7 8 8 <include package="quintagroup.transmogrifier" /> … … 19 19 <utility 20 20 component=".adapters.ImageFolderSection" 21 name="quintagroup.transmogrif ier.simpleblog2quills.imagefolder"21 name="quintagroup.transmogrify.simpleblog2quills.imagefolder" 22 22 provides="collective.transmogrifier.interfaces.ISectionBlueprint" 23 23 /> … … 148 148 149 149 <adapter 150 for="quintagroup.transmogrif ier.simpleblog2quills.interfaces.IBaseObject"150 for="quintagroup.transmogrify.simpleblog2quills.interfaces.IBaseObject" 151 151 provides="quintagroup.transmogrifier.interfaces.IImportDataCorrector" 152 152 factory=".adapters.WorkflowImporter" … … 158 158 <utility 159 159 component=".activator.BlogActivatorSection" 160 name="quintagroup.transmogrif ier.simpleblog2quills.activator"160 name="quintagroup.transmogrify.simpleblog2quills.activator" 161 161 provides="collective.transmogrifier.interfaces.ISectionBlueprint" 162 162 /> -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/export.cfg
r1218 r1490 52 52 # in this section you must write you site URL 53 53 [imagefolder] 54 blueprint = quintagroup.transmogrif ier.simpleblog2quills.imagefolder54 blueprint = quintagroup.transmogrify.simpleblog2quills.imagefolder 55 55 site-urls = 56 56 -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/import.cfg
r1244 r1490 42 42 43 43 [activator] 44 blueprint = quintagroup.transmogrif ier.simpleblog2quills.activator44 blueprint = quintagroup.transmogrify.simpleblog2quills.activator -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/itemmanipulator.py
r532 r1490 5 5 from collective.transmogrifier.utils import defaultMatcher 6 6 7 from quintagroup.transmogrif ier.simpleblog2quills.interfaces import \7 from quintagroup.transmogrify.simpleblog2quills.interfaces import \ 8 8 IItemManipulator, IExportItemManipulator, IImportItemManipulator 9 9 -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/tests/source.txt
r359 r1490 9 9 ... 10 10 ... [source] 11 ... blueprint = quintagroup.transmogrif ier.simpleblog2quills.tests.source11 ... blueprint = quintagroup.transmogrify.simpleblog2quills.tests.source 12 12 ... source = marshall 13 13 ... items = … … 19 19 ... blueprint = collective.transmogrifier.sections.tests.pprinter 20 20 ... """ 21 >>> registerConfig(u'quintagroup.transmogrif ier.simpleblog2quills.tests.source', source)22 >>> transmogrifier(u'quintagroup.transmogrif ier.simpleblog2quills.tests.source') # doctest: +ELLIPSIS, +REPORT_NDIFF21 >>> registerConfig(u'quintagroup.transmogrify.simpleblog2quills.tests.source', source) 22 >>> transmogrifier(u'quintagroup.transmogrify.simpleblog2quills.tests.source') # doctest: +ELLIPSIS, +REPORT_NDIFF 23 23 {'_files': {'marshall': {'data': ...}}, 24 24 '_path': 'plone-blog', … … 34 34 ... 35 35 ... [source] 36 ... blueprint = quintagroup.transmogrif ier.simpleblog2quills.tests.source36 ... blueprint = quintagroup.transmogrify.simpleblog2quills.tests.source 37 37 ... allow-empty-items = yes 38 38 ... source = marshall … … 45 45 ... blueprint = collective.transmogrifier.sections.tests.pprinter 46 46 ... """ 47 >>> registerConfig(u'quintagroup.transmogrif ier.simpleblog2quills.tests.source-with-empties', source)48 >>> transmogrifier(u'quintagroup.transmogrif ier.simpleblog2quills.tests.source-with-empties') # doctest: +ELLIPSIS, +REPORT_NDIFF47 >>> registerConfig(u'quintagroup.transmogrify.simpleblog2quills.tests.source-with-empties', source) 48 >>> transmogrifier(u'quintagroup.transmogrify.simpleblog2quills.tests.source-with-empties') # doctest: +ELLIPSIS, +REPORT_NDIFF 49 49 {'_type': 'Document', '_path': 'not-existing'} 50 50 {'_type': 'File', '_path': 'not-existing'} -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/tests/test_base.py
r359 r1490 8 8 from quintagroup.transmogrifier.tests import sectionsSetUp 9 9 10 import quintagroup.transmogrif ier.simpleblog2quills.tests10 import quintagroup.transmogrify.simpleblog2quills.tests 11 11 12 12 def sourceSetUp(test): 13 13 sectionsSetUp(test) 14 zcml.load_config('test_import.zcml', quintagroup.transmogrif ier.simpleblog2quills.tests)14 zcml.load_config('test_import.zcml', quintagroup.transmogrify.simpleblog2quills.tests) 15 15 16 16 def test_suite(): -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/tests/test_import.cfg
r359 r1490 11 11 12 12 [source] 13 blueprint = quintagroup.transmogrif ier.simpleblog2quills.tests.source13 blueprint = quintagroup.transmogrify.simpleblog2quills.tests.source 14 14 source = marshall 15 15 allow-empty-items = yes -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/tests/test_import.py
r359 r1490 14 14 15 15 ztc.installProduct('Quills') 16 ztc.installProduct('fatsyndication') 16 17 17 18 @onsetup … … 20 21 import Products.Five 21 22 zcml.load_config('configure.zcml', Products.Five) 22 import quintagroup.transmogrif ier.simpleblog2quills23 zcml.load_config('configure.zcml', quintagroup.transmogrif ier.simpleblog2quills)24 import quintagroup.transmogrif ier.simpleblog2quills.tests25 zcml.load_config('test_import.zcml', quintagroup.transmogrif ier.simpleblog2quills.tests)23 import quintagroup.transmogrify.simpleblog2quills 24 zcml.load_config('configure.zcml', quintagroup.transmogrify.simpleblog2quills) 25 import quintagroup.transmogrify.simpleblog2quills.tests 26 zcml.load_config('test_import.zcml', quintagroup.transmogrify.simpleblog2quills.tests) 26 27 # this is needed because 'importStep' unknown directive error is raised somewhere 27 28 import Products.GenericSetup -
quintagroup.transmogrify.simpleblog2quills/trunk/quintagroup/transmogrify/simpleblog2quills/tests/test_import.zcml
r359 r1490 5 5 <utility 6 6 component=".base.Source" 7 name="quintagroup.transmogrif ier.simpleblog2quills.tests.source"7 name="quintagroup.transmogrify.simpleblog2quills.tests.source" 8 8 /> 9 9 -
quintagroup.transmogrify.simpleblog2quills/trunk/setup.py
r293 r1490 4 4 version = '0.1' 5 5 6 setup(name='quintagroup.transmogrif ier.simpleblog2quills',6 setup(name='quintagroup.transmogrify.simpleblog2quills', 7 7 version=version, 8 8 description="Configuration of collective.transmogrifier pipeline for migrating SimpleBlog content to Quills content", … … 20 20 license='GPL', 21 21 packages=find_packages(exclude=['ez_setup']), 22 namespace_packages=['quintagroup', 'quintagroup.transmogrif ier'],22 namespace_packages=['quintagroup', 'quintagroup.transmogrify'], 23 23 include_package_data=True, 24 24 zip_safe=False,
Note: See TracChangeset
for help on using the changeset viewer.